Question 8

The diagram shows a side-on view of two cables for a transit system. The equations of the cables are y=2x+4y = 2x + 4y=2x+4 and y=−43x−1\displaystyle y = -\frac{4}{3}x - 1y=−34​x−1.

A Cartesian coordinate system showing two intersecting straight lines. One line has a positive slope and the other has a negative slope. They intersect in the second quadrant.

Work out the coordinates of the point where the cables intersect.

[3]
